The cherry blossoms are perhaps the most anticipated event in Washington D.C. It’s hard to know with precision when they’ll bloom and how long they’ll last. Strong winds, rain, and other weather conditions can make them disappear very quickly. The entire blooming period can last up to 14 days, including the days leading up to peak bloom, but it can also come and go very quickly, that’s why I call it Evanescent.



The word Danger usually gets my attention. While walking around Barcelona recently, I saw a sign, written in Catalan, that actually amused me because I couldn’t figure out its exact meaning. “Perill Indefinit.” Hmmm… Indefinite Danger? Does it mean there’s no way of knowing what terrible things might happen? Or does it just mean great danger? I never found the answer, but I figured I shouldn’t go in there because I didn’t have a “casc” and, most importantly, because I was not involved in the construction work. The second sign helped a little… 🙂
